Signs It's Time to Replace Double Glazing
Over time, double glazing can degrade. Here are some common signs that it may be time to consider a replacement.
1. Condensation between Panes
One of the most typical indications of a failing double glazing system is condensation forming between the glass panes. This indicates that the seal has actually broken, allowing wetness to get in the space in between the panes.
2. Drafts and Cold Spots
If you see cold drafts or specific areas in your home that are consistently cooler than others, it might indicate that your double glazing is no longer providing adequate insulation.
3. Increased Energy Bills
Substantial increases in your energy costs can signal ineffective windows. If your double glazing is not working properly, your heating or cooling systems should work more difficult to preserve a comfy temperature level.
4. Problem Opening or Closing Windows
If your windows are warping or you discover it progressively challenging to operate them, this might recommend that the frames are deteriorating, making replacement essential.
5. Noticeable Damage
Cracks, chips, or tarnished glass substantially jeopardize your windows' efficiency and visual appeal. Such visible damage warrants replacement for both performance and curb appeal.
The Replacement Process
Action 1: Assessment
Before devoting to replacement, it's smart to have a professional evaluate your present windows. They can identify whether replacement or repair work is the very best alternative.
Action 2: Choosing New Double Glazing
When selecting brand-new double glazing, think about elements like energy performance rankings, design, and frame products. You can go with:
- uPVC: Known for sturdiness and low upkeep
- Aluminium: Offers a modern-day look and high strength
- Wood: Provides natural charm but requires more maintenance
Step 3: Installation
Expert installation is important for the effectiveness of your double glazing. A knowledgeable installer will make sure correct sealing and fitting, minimizing the risks of future concerns.
Step 4: Review
After installation, examine your new windows. Guarantee they are working properly which you are pleased with the quality of work.
Cost of Double Glazing Replacement
The cost of replacing double glazing can vary extensively based upon numerous factors, consisting of the size of the windows, the type of glass, and labor expenses. Here is a rough estimate:
Window Type
Average Cost (per window)
Standard uPVC
₤ 300 – ₤ 800
Aluminium
₤ 600 – ₤ 1200
Wood
₤ 800 – ₤ 2000
Specialized Shapes
₤ 1000 – ₤ 3000
Keep in mind: Above costs can differ based upon area, window size, and extra functions like tinted glass or advanced energy-efficient finishes.
Often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. The length of time does double glazing last?
Typically, double glazing lasts in between 20 to 35 years, depending on the quality and upkeep.
2. Can I replace simply one pane of a double-glazed unit?
Most of the times, the entire system should be replaced to make sure correct sealing and insulation.
3. Is it worth changing old double glazing?
Yes, changing old or damaged double glazing can lead to much better energy performance, decreased energy bills, and improved home comfort.
4. How can I keep double glazing?
Keep frames clean, examine seals for damage, and make sure proper ventilation to reduce condensation.
5. Exist any government grants for double glazing replacement?
In some areas, grants or incentives might be available for energy-efficient home enhancements, consisting of double glazing. Contact your city government for readily available alternatives.
